Example: Les chercheurs ont mis au jour des preuves inédites.
Definition
"Mettre au jour" means to uncover or reveal something previously hidden or unknown, especially in the context of discoveries or research. For example, it involves bringing to light new evidence or facts that were not known before.

Etymology
The phrase "mettre au jour" literally means 'to put to the day' in French, reflecting the idea of bringing something into the light or making it visible. It originates from the use of 'jour' meaning 'day' or 'light,' symbolizing revelation or discovery.
